The governor of Antioquia, Andrés Julián Rendón Cardona, warned that the electoral risk in the department has increased due to the presence and expansion of illegal armed groups in several subregions. He explained that the activity of dissident groups from the former FARC is generating pressure and constraints that could affect the normal course of the upcoming elections. The governor of Antioquia, Andrés Julián Rendón, requested military actions against alias ‘Calarcá’ to guarantee the electoral process during the first half of the year. ‘Calarcá’, leader of the FARC’s dissidents, who ordered criminal actions in the north and north-east, apparently committed crimes in conjunction with the ELN in Antioquia.
